Pink Lady apples cooked down with brown sugar, warm cinnamon, and a splash of honey-lemon tea create the base for these flaky caramelized puff pastry pockets. The fruit softens into a jammy consistency that contrasts beautifully against the shatteringly crisp, buttery dough. A dusting of sesame seeds adds a subtle, nutty crunch that elevates the otherwise simple preparation.

These handheld pastries are straightforward enough for a weekend brunch or a quick afternoon pick-me-up. The contrast between the tender, spiced apple filling and the golden-brown crust makes them particularly satisfying when served warm. Drizzling them with a bit of prepared caramel and pairing them with a scoop of vanilla ice cream turns these turnovers into an effortless dessert that relies on pantry staples.

Key Ingredients

  • Puff pastry: Forms the golden, crispy exterior shell that encases the sweet apple filling.
  • Pink Lady apples: Provides the sweet, tender fruit base for the caramelized pastry filling.
  • Caramel sauce: Drizzled over the finished pastries to add a rich, buttery sweetness.
  • Cinnamon: Infuses the apple filling with a warm, aromatic spice profile.
  • Brown sugar: Caramelizes with the apples to create a deep, molasses-like sweetness.
  • Lemon honey tea: Incorporated into the filling to provide a unique, subtle floral citrus note.
